One of the leading players in the private jet charter membership market is Wheels Up, which has gained significant traction since its inception in 2013. The company offers a range of membership options, from individual to corporate plans, catering to various travel needs. Members benefit from access to a large fleet of aircraft, including light, mid-size, and large jets, as well as a dedicated concierge service to assist with travel arrangements. Wheels Up has positioned itself as a lifestyle brand, emphasizing the luxury and exclusivity associated with private aviation.
Another notable contender is NetJets, a subsidiary of Berkshire Hathaway, which has been a pioneer in the fractional ownership model since the 1960s. NetJets has adapted to the changing market by introducing a membership program that allows clients to access its fleet of over 700 aircraft without the long-term commitment of ownership. This flexibility has attracted a new generation of travelers who prioritize access over ownership, aligning perfectly with the concept of shared economy that has gained popularity in recent years.

Despite the allure of private jet travel, potential members should be aware of the costs associated with charter membership programs. While they provide significant advantages, the initial membership fee and ongoing hourly rates can be substantial. For instance, Wheels Up charges a one-time membership fee that can range from $2,995 to $29,500, depending on the plan, in addition to hourly rates that vary based on the aircraft type and route. However, for those who frequently travel for business or leisure, the costs can often be justified by the time saved and the enhanced travel experience.
